Book Lovers’ Dilemma: The Art of Moving with Your Library

Moving to a new home is an exciting opportunity for a fresh start and a chance to organize your belongings. However, if you’re an avid book lover with an extensive collection, deciding what to do with all those books can present a unique challenge. Whether your shelves are overflowing with novels, textbooks, or collector’s items, it’s essential to have a plan in place for packing and handling your beloved literary treasures during a move.

One of the first steps to take when preparing to move your books is to assess your collection. Start by sorting through your books and determining which ones you want to keep, donate, sell, or discard. This process can help you reduce the number of books you need to pack and transport, making your move easier and more efficient.

For the books you decide to keep, it’s crucial to pack them carefully to prevent damage during transit. Consider investing in sturdy moving boxes of various sizes to accommodate different types of books. Use packing paper or bubble wrap to protect fragile or valuable books, and pack them snugly to prevent shifting during the move.

When packing your books, aim to keep boxes manageable in size and weight to make them easier to lift and transport. Avoid overfilling boxes with too many books, as this can cause them to become heavy and difficult to carry. Instead, distribute books evenly among boxes and consider using smaller boxes for heavier items like hardcover books.

If you have rare or valuable books in your collection, consider packing them separately or transporting them with you personally to ensure their safety. Additionally, keep moisture and temperature levels in mind to prevent damage to your books, especially if you’re moving long distance or storing them in a non-climate-controlled environment.

Once you’ve packed your books, make sure to label each box clearly with its contents and destination room in your new home. This will make unpacking much smoother and help you locate specific books quickly once you’ve settled into your new space.

If you have books that you no longer want to keep, consider donating them to a local library, school, or charity organization. Many places welcome book donations and will put them to good use, allowing you to declutter your collection while supporting a good cause.

In conclusion, moving with a large book collection may require extra time and effort, but with proper planning and organization, you can ensure that your books arrive at your new home safe and sound. By assessing your collection, packing carefully, and considering options for books you no longer need, you can streamline the moving process and start enjoying your books in your new space.
